This position is to assist in providing leadership and direction for management and operations associated with the Goodwill Education and Training Center. The primary goal is to assist in directing and ensuring the continued program growth achieved through established benchmarks, compliance with standardized systems of management, customized services to meet local employment and training needs, community partnerships, and identified funding opportunities.

Essential Job Functions

  • Assures program compliance with all policies, procedures, and practices established within the department and is responsible for holding staff accountable for discrepancies in practice.
  • Spearheads maintenance of integrity of data entry/management and accuracy of reports, documentation, and records, through quarterly site-based audits conducted by senior management followed by a written summary of findings.
  • Plays key role in cultivation of strong collaborative relationships with current and new community partners.
  • Ensures ongoing program evaluation of current process and implantation of new practices.
  • Ability to articulate mission services and the ability to lead and motivate others to achieve established benchmarks.
  • Oversees and coordinates schedules and workload of GETC programs and services.
  • Participate in and gives input on all CARF standards and plans. Responsible for assigned areas within CARF standards and/or action plans.
  • Responsible for development of training topics, training aides, and activities for the consumers, participants and Education and Training Center.
  • May provide direction to participants about work tutorials and on-site mentoring.
  • Provide career counseling to assist clients with identifying skills and developing appropriate vocational goals.
  • Maintain regular contact with client to monitor and revise ISS as required. Provide 12 month follow-up activities after exit from program.
  • Work with participants on case load in the development of an Individual Service Strategy. Assist with identifying and addressing youth barriers.
  • Work closely with community agencies and staff of County Department of Job and Family Services. Make appropriate referral for service including the provision of required support services.
  • Present and facilitate learning through a variety of delivery methods.
  • Evaluate and make recommendations on training materials and methodology.
  • Keeps accurate case notes and paperwork on all consumer files.
  • Keep accurate accounts of all billable time providing necessary information for billing and mileage.
  • Ensures that confidentiality is maintained in all areas of program operations. Barriers to employment of each consumer should be maintained and disclosed only as allowable under state and federal law, and on a need-to-know basis.
  • Responsible for developing new referrals including calling, sending letters, prison visits, and community relationships. Carries out marketing strategies designed to maximize program utilization.
  • Development of funding sources including grant writing, when available.
  • Attends conferences, seminars, workshops and meetings of professional groups and other to further Goodwill's objectives. Travel for training may be required.
  • Follows safety policies and procedures.
  • Appropriately dressed in accordance with the employee dress code.
  • Perform other duties that may be assigned.

Critical Skills

Academic preparation at the bachelor's degree level preferred or two (2) years associates degree with management experience accepted; must be innovative, with outstanding track record for partnering to address workforce needs; must be capable of effectively using organizational and planning skills with attention to detail and follow through; requires strong communication skills, both verbal and written; must effectively lead, supervise, train, and develop staff; desire to work with rehabilitation consumers, employees, and the public; team oriented; appropriate grooming and dress; First Aid CPR Certified (training provided); credentials and criminal background check required; able to pass alcohol/drug screening; maintain a valid driver's license, a driving record acceptable to Goodwill's insurance provider (or review/waiver signed by President/CEO) and adequate personal liability insurance.
